Вопрос задан 10.10.2023 в 19:05. Предмет Информатика. Спрашивает Касумова Диана.

составить программу, которая формирует массив из 13 случайных целых чисел, принадлежащих промежутку

[-20;20] и выводит эти числа в строку через запятую
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Чернядьев Никита.
Var
  A: array [1..13] of integer;
  i: byte;
begin
randomize;
  for i := 1 to 13 do
  begin
    A[i] := random(41)-20;
    write(A[i],', ');
  end;  
end.
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Конечно! Вот пример программы на Python, которая делает то, что вы описали:

python
import random def generate_random_numbers(): random_numbers = [random.randint(-20, 20) for _ in range(13)] return random_numbers def main(): random_numbers = generate_random_numbers() numbers_string = ', '.join(map(str, random_numbers)) print(numbers_string) if __name__ == "__main__": main()

Эта программа использует модуль random, чтобы сгенерировать 13 случайных целых чисел в заданном диапазоне [-20, 20]. Функция generate_random_numbers создает и возвращает массив из этих чисел. Затем эти числа преобразуются в строки и объединяются через запятую с помощью ', '.join(map(str, random_numbers)). В итоге программа выводит эти числа через запятую.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ос